About Dr. Behan
Practice. Dr. Branislav Behan is a board-certified orthopedic surgeon practicing in Hannibal, Missouri. The latest annual CMS data records 20 knee replacements and 11 hip replacements, 31 procedures in all. That is #127 in Missouri for knee replacement. A Medicare provider since 2006.
Trend. Medicare records run from 2013 to 2024, 12 years. Volume peaked at 61 in 2019 and stands at 31 now. Reporting changes and payer mix can both move that number.
National context. Among 6,612 knee replacement surgeons tracked nationally, 20 procedures is below the national average of 45. Medicare covers part of all joint replacements, so true volume is likely higher.
Local context. Hannibal has 4 orthopedic surgeons in the current Medicare data. Comparing volume and procedure mix across them is one way to narrow a shortlist. Dr. Behan also holds hospital privileges in MO and MI, a practice that extends beyond Missouri.

Verified Medicare Cases
How is this estimated?
Medicare Part B fee-for-service claims are one payer stream among several, and the share they represent differs by procedure. In 2024 it was 23% to 28% for knee replacement, 25% to 33% for hip replacement. Each verified count above is divided by its own procedure's range, and the results are added, to estimate total practice volume across all payers. The verified Medicare count is the definitive, audited figure; this is a range derived from published national volume projections, not a measurement, and an individual practice can sit well outside it: how these ranges are derived, and their sources.

What does the Medicare data for Dr. Behan represent?
The procedure counts shown are based on 2024 Medicare Part B fee-for-service claims data, published by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S). Medicare fee-for-service is only one payer stream, and the share of national volume it represents differs by procedure. In 2024 the share was 23% to 28% for knee replacement, 25% to 33% for hip replacement, which puts Dr. Behan's total volume across all insurers at roughly 100 to 130 procedures against the 31 verified here. Those shares are derived from published national volume projections rather than quoted from a single publication, and they are estimates with real uncertainty.
